9-Hydroxy-2-decenoic acid

Base Information Edit
  • Chemical Name:9-Hydroxy-2-decenoic acid
  • CAS No.:4448-33-3
  • Molecular Formula:C10H18O3
  • Molecular Weight:186.251

Chemical Property of 9-Hydroxy-2-decenoic acid Edit
Chemical Property:
  • Vapor Pressure:2.87E-06mmHg at 25°C 
  • Boiling Point:349.3oC at 760 mmHg 
  • Flash Point:179.3oC 
  • PSA:57.53000 
  • Density:1.036g/cm3 
  • LogP:1.95850 
  • XLogP3:2.1
  • Hydrogen Bond Donor Count:2
  • Hydrogen Bond Acceptor Count:3
  • Rotatable Bond Count:7
  • Exact Mass:186.125594432
  • Heavy Atom Count:13
  • Complexity:164
